Patch-Source: https://sources.debian.org/data/main/e/emacsql/3.1.1%2Bgit20230417.6401226%2Bds-2/debian/patches/compile-against-system-libsqlite3-and-use-Debian-CFLAGS.patch -- From: Sean Whitton Date: Thu, 11 Jun 2020 18:17:54 -0700 Subject: compile against system libsqlite3 and use Debian CFLAGS --- sqlite/Makefile | 8 ++++---- sqlite/emacsql.c | 2 +-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/sqlite/Makefile b/sqlite/Makefile index 14b2798..4e2dc42 100644 --- a/sqlite/Makefile +++ b/sqlite/Makefile @@ -1,8 +1,8 @@ -include ../.config.mk .POSIX: -LDLIBS = -ldl -lm -CFLAGS = -O2 -Wall -Wextra -Wno-implicit-fallthrough \ +LDLIBS = -lsqlite3 +CFLAGS += -Wno-implicit-fallthrough \ -DSQLITE_THREADSAFE=0 \ -DSQLITE_DEFAULT_FOREIGN_KEYS=1 \ -DSQLITE_ENABLE_FTS5 \ @@ -12,8 +12,8 @@ CFLAGS = -O2 -Wall -Wextra -Wno-implicit-fallthrough \ -DSQLITE_ENABLE_JSON1 \ -DSQLITE_SOUNDEX -emacsql-sqlite: emacsql.c sqlite3.c - $(CC) $(CFLAGS) $(LDFLAGS) -o $@ emacsql.c sqlite3.c $(LDLIBS) +emacsql-sqlite: emacsql.c + $(CC) $(CFLAGS) $(LDFLAGS) -o $@ emacsql.c $(LDLIBS) clean: rm -f emacsql-sqlite diff --git a/sqlite/emacsql.c b/sqlite/emacsql.c index 5c5c0f7..b9b7dc9 100644 --- a/sqlite/emacsql.c +++ b/sqlite/emacsql.c @@ -3,7 +3,7 @@ #include #include #include -#include "sqlite3.h" +#include #define TRUE 1 #define FALSE 0